Deep foundation installation services involve the process of placing strong, stable supports beneath a building or structure to ensure its stability and safety. These services typically include methods such as drilled shafts, piles, or caissons, which are driven or drilled deep into the ground to reach stable soil or bedrock. The goal is to transfer the load of the structure safely to the ground below the surface, especially when shallow foundations are insufficient due to poor soil conditions or high load requirements. Professional contractors use specialized equipment and techniques to accurately install these deep supports, providing a solid base that can withstand various environmental and structural stresses.

These services are essential for solving problems related to unstable or weak soil conditions that can cause settling, shifting, or even structural failure over time. When a property’s foundation is compromised or when new construction projects encounter challenging ground conditions, deep foundation installation can provide a reliable solution. It is also useful for properties built on expansive clay, loose or sandy soils, or areas prone to flooding or erosion. By installing deep supports, homeowners and builders can prevent costly repairs, uneven settling, or dangerous structural issues in the future.

What types of deep foundation installation services are available? Local contractors offer various methods such as drilled shafts, piles, and caissons to support different types of construction projects.

How do I know which deep foundation method is suitable for my project? Consulting with experienced service providers can help determine the most appropriate foundation type based on soil conditions and structural requirements.

What equipment is typically used during deep foundation installation? Contractors utilize equipment like drilling rigs, pile drivers, and augers to install deep foundations efficiently and accurately.

Are there specific site conditions that affect deep foundation installation? Yes, factors such as soil type, water table level, and nearby structures can influence the choice and complexity of foundation installation methods.

How do local service providers ensure proper installation of deep foundations? Professionals follow established industry practices and use specialized equipment to ensure the stability and integrity of the installed foundations.
